Output 667ba249a41ebafcf123f6d32079c88b6374ead31a2e532f13defe47cfb4d624:1

value
10821075
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13a46890d8f5e367820dea524fba03bfa7bcf328 OP_EQUALVERIFY OP_CHECKSIG
address
12nrnwoVpdocS8npDPwZbAKk4o51r7hqXD
transaction
667ba249a41ebafcf123f6d32079c88b6374ead31a2e532f13defe47cfb4d624
spent
true